2 Kings 15:17-22

Menahem Pays Tribute to Assyria

2 Kings 15:17-22
17
It was in the thirty-ninth year of 'Azaryah king of Y'hudah that Menachem the son of Gadi began his reign over Isra'el; he ruled ten years in Shomron.
18
He did what was evil from ADONAI's perspective; throughout his life he did not turn from the sins of Yarov'am the son of N'vat, who made Isra'el sin.
19
Pul the king of Ashur invaded the land. Menachem gave Pul thirty-three tons of silver, so that he would confirm Menachem's hold on the kingdom.
20
He did this by taxing the wealthy men in Isra'el; from each he required one-and-a-quarter pounds of silver to give to the king of Ashur. Then the king of Ashur turned around and left the land.
21
Other activities of Menachem and all his accomplishments are recorded in the Annals of the Kings of Isra'el.
22
Menachem slept with his ancestors, and P'kachyah his son took his place as king.
